使用Visual Studio 2017 RC,我收到此编译错误:
LINK:致命错误LNK1181:无法打开输入文件'C:\ Program Files(x86)\ Microsoft Visual Studio \ 2017 \ Community \ VC \ Tools \ MSVC \ 14.10.24728 \ lib \ x86.obj'
x86.obj在我的系统上不存在。然而,编译器想要链接到它,虽然我没有在项目属性中指示。它是否将文件夹名称($(VC_LibraryPath_x86))误解为它必须链接的对象?这可能是个错误吗?
另一方面,我发现在Visual Studio 2015中也会出现类似的问题,甚至还有一个(未答复的)问题:LNK1104 cannot open file '...lib.obj'
有谁知道这里出了什么问题?感谢。
- 诊断构建输出:
LINK:致命错误LNK1104:无法打开文件'C:\ Program Files(x86)\ Microsoft Visual Studio \ 2017 \ Community \ VC \ Tools \ MSVC \ 14.10.24728 \ lib \ x86.obj'
该命令退出代码1104。
输出属性:LinkSkippedExecution = False
完成执行任务“链接” - 失败。